Output 80e873231598991ab4347013b2c591332f012a705e939627e549f202de6e50dc:66

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f4cfe3876a79174fe4fcaf37249149251d019539ce3b34a933ff9e6daeed77a7
address
bc1p7n878pm20yt5le8u4umjfy2fy5wsr9feecanf2fnl70xmthdw7ns9h6rl5
transaction
80e873231598991ab4347013b2c591332f012a705e939627e549f202de6e50dc
spent
true